Effect of Seed-Fertilizer Distance with Soil Moisture and Fertilizer Application Levels on the Emergence and Initial Growth of Barley

Abstract
In order to study the effect of seed-fertilizer vertical distance with soil moisture and fertilizer levels on the emergence and initial growth, barley cv. Olbori was seeded in the pots filled with sandy loam or loamy sand soils which were adjusted to 80-100% (higher soil moisture) or 50-60% (lower soil moisture) of soil moisture retention percent at 1/10 atmosphere tension.
